Montenegro

Located in Southeastern Europe on the Balkan Peninsula, Montenegro is renowned for its breathtaking and unmatched natural beauty. Having gained sovereignty in 2006, Montenegro is a NATO member, adopts the euro as its currency, and holds the status of an official candidate country for EU membership.

Montenegro showcases vast and unspoiled mountain peaks, gleaming lakes, and a welcoming population of 605,000 known for their warm hospitality. At the heart of the country lies the majestic Mount Lovćen, while its captivating Adriatic Coast stretches 273 km, adorned with pristine sandy beaches and the exclusive Porto Montenegro—a rising luxury spot in Europe. This natural harbor attracts superyachts, helicopters, lavish properties, and vibrant nightclubs.

Nearby, the medieval town of Kotor,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, boasts a captivating blend of Venetian, Austrian, and baroque-style architecture, set against a picturesque mountain backdrop. Tourism serves as the cornerstone of the country's safe and stable economy, consistently earning Montenegro a prominent place among the world's top tourist destinations.

Montenegro's rapid economic growth has earned it the distinction of being one of the fastest-growing Balkan economies, transforming it into a pivotal strategic hub for global industries. The official language is Montenegrin, with Serbian, Bosnian, and Croatian also spoken. Montenegro adopts the euro as its official currency.

Requirements for Acquiring Montenegro Citizenship through Investment

To be eligible for the Montenegro Citizenship by Investment Program, the main applicant must be 18 years or older, fulfill application requirements, and make qualifying contributions to the Government of Montenegro. Two routes are available:

  • EUR 450,000 investment in projects in Podgorica or coastal regions.
  • EUR 250,000 investment in projects in northern or central Montenegro, excluding Podgorica.

Additionally, a government fee of EUR 200,000 per application is required, with EUR 100,000 going to an underdeveloped areas fund and EUR 100,000 to the Innovation Fund of Montenegro.
